分享好友 数智知识首页 数智知识分类 切换频道

c语言开发应用程序是什么,C语言开发应用程序概述

C语言开发应用程序是一种利用C语言进行软件开发的过程,它涉及到理解C语言的特性、掌握C语言的编程技巧以及熟悉C语言在不同领域的应用。下面将详细介绍C语言开发应用程序的相关内容。...
2025-01-21 10:10100

C语言开发应用程序是一种利用C语言进行软件开发的过程,它涉及到理解C语言的特性、掌握C语言的编程技巧以及熟悉C语言在不同领域的应用。下面将详细介绍C语言开发应用程序的相关内容:

1. C语言的基础概念

  • 语言起源与发展:C语言起源于1972年,由丹尼斯·里奇在贝尔实验室开发。作为计算机程序设计语言,C语言以其高效性和底层硬件控制能力,广泛应用于系统级应用和需要高性能的场景。
  • 语言特性:C语言具有高效的执行速度,适合编写操作系统内核和嵌入式系统软件。同时,C语言的结构式和结构化特点使得代码易于阅读和维护。

2. C语言在软件开发中的应用

  • 系统级应用:C语言因其底层硬件控制能力,成为编写操作系统内核的首选语言,例如UNIX、Linux和Windows系统的内核都大量运用了C语言。
  • 软件开发:C语言也被广泛用于编写各种应用程序,如图形用户界面程序、网络服务器程序等。

3. C语言的应用实例

  • 简单计算器:使用C语言实现一个简单的计算器功能,包括加、减、乘、除操作。
  • 通讯录:通过结构体、数组、链表等概念,实现一个包含联系人信息的通讯录。
  • 日历功能:利用C语言实现一个简单的日历功能,输入相应的年/月即可查看当月的日历。
  • 小游戏:用C语言开发一个简单的游戏,如五子棋或扫雷游戏,不仅锻炼编程技能,还能学习相关的算法知识。

c语言开发应用程序是什么,C语言开发应用程序概述

4. C语言开发应用程序的关键步骤

  • 需求分析:明确应用的功能和性能要求,为后续的开发工作提供指导。
  • 设计程序结构:根据需求设计合理的程序结构,确保代码结构清晰、逻辑性强。
  • 编写代码:按照设计的程序结构编写具体的代码,注意遵循C语言的语法和规范。
  • 调试与优化:对编写的代码进行调试,发现并修复错误,并进行性能优化,提高程序的运行效率。

除了上述关于C语言开发应用程序的内容外,还可以关注以下几个方面:

  • 学习和实践C语言的基本语法和结构,为后续的学习打下坚实基础。
  • 了解C语言在不同领域的应用,拓宽知识面,提高解决实际问题的能力。
  • 学习C语言开发应用程序的常用工具和技术,如集成开发环境(IDE)、版本控制系统等。
  • 参与开源项目或社区,与其他开发者交流经验,共同进步。

总的来说,C语言开发应用程序是计算机科学领域的重要组成部分,它不仅能够帮助人们理解和掌握编程语言的基本概念,还能够培养解决问题的能力和创新思维。通过学习和实践,不仅可以提高个人的编程技能,还能够为未来的职业发展奠定坚实的基础。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化136条点评

4.5星

简道云

低代码开发平台85条点评

4.5星

帆软FineBI

商业智能软件93条点评

4.5星

纷享销客CRM

客户管理系统105条点评

4.5星

推荐知识更多